External diskdrive "DF1" as Internal!!
`Have anyone done this... turned the external connector around and use the "DF1" as internal in an amiga 1200Tower?
I wanna try ;-) |

well, you can't really turn it around..
But you can however connect DS1 from the external drive port to the internal port's DS1 pin and then you could use two floppy drives on the same cable. You will need a similar circuit that is inside the external drive inbetween the cable and the drive for trackdisk.device to be able to detect it. Take a look on Aminet hard/hacks, there's some "add external drive" articles there, where you can take the rdy pulsing circuit. |
